Guzheng, as one of the most representative Chinese instruments, first appeared around the Warring States period (475 – 221 BC), then became extremely popular during the Tang Dynasty (618 – 907 AD) and spread to all neighboring areas ever since (e.g., Guzheng is the forefather of Japanese Koto). The Guzheng is a Chinese plucked zither, ancestor of several Asian instruments such as the Japanese koto, the Mongolian Yatga and the Korean gayageum. It has 21 strings and movable bridges. 5 articulations: fingers, pick, stick, bow and ebow. Up to 4x round robin and 4 velocity layers.
